What Are the 5 Components of Physical Fitness?
Physical fitness is a state of well-being that allows individuals to perform daily activities with ease while maintaining optimal health. It is crucial to maintain a balanced level of physical fitness to enhance overall health and reduce the risk of chronic diseases. Physical fitness comprises several components that work together to ensure a well-rounded approach to fitness. In this article, we will explore the five components of physical fitness and their importance.
1. Cardiovascular Endurance: This component refers to the ability of the heart, lungs, and blood vessels to deliver oxygen and nutrients to the working muscles during physical activity. Activities such as running, swimming, and cycling improve cardiovascular endurance.
2. Muscular Strength: Muscular strength is the ability of muscles to exert force against resistance. It is crucial for activities that involve lifting, pushing, or pulling. Strength training exercises like weightlifting increase muscular strength.
3. Muscular Endurance: Muscular endurance refers to the ability of muscles to sustain repeated contractions or hold a position for an extended period. It is essential for activities that require prolonged muscle use, like running or cycling. Exercises such as planks and push-ups improve muscular endurance.
4. Flexibility: Flexibility is the range of motion around a joint. It allows individuals to move freely without restriction. Stretching exercises and activities like yoga or Pilates improve flexibility.
5. Body Composition: Body composition is the proportion of fat, muscle, and other tissues in the body. It is important to maintain a healthy body composition to reduce the risk of obesity and related health issues. A balanced diet and regular exercise contribute to a healthy body composition.
Now, let’s address some common questions related to the components of physical fitness:
1. Why is cardiovascular endurance important?
Cardiovascular endurance is important because it strengthens the heart and lungs, improves circulation, and reduces the risk of heart disease.
2. How can I improve muscular strength?
Muscular strength can be improved through resistance training exercises such as weightlifting or using resistance bands.
3. Why is muscular endurance important?
Muscular endurance is important because it allows us to perform activities for a longer duration without feeling fatigued.
4. What are some flexibility exercises?
Stretching exercises, yoga, and Pilates are excellent ways to improve flexibility.
5. Is body composition only about weight?
No, body composition is not just about weight. It involves the proportion of fat, muscle, and other tissues in the body.
6. How can I improve my body composition?
Maintaining a balanced diet, engaging in regular physical activity, and incorporating strength training exercises can help improve body composition.
7. Can I focus on just one component of fitness?
While it is possible to focus on one component of fitness, it is important to maintain a well-rounded approach to achieve overall physical fitness.
8. How often should I engage in cardiovascular exercises?
It is recommended to engage in cardiovascular exercises for at least 150 minutes per week, spread over several sessions.
9. Should I lift heavy weights to improve muscular strength?
Lifting heavy weights can improve muscular strength, but it is important to start with lighter weights and gradually increase the load to avoid injury.
10. Can stretching exercises improve flexibility?
Yes, regular stretching exercises can improve flexibility and help maintain joint mobility.
11. Are bodyweight exercises effective for improving muscular strength?
Yes, bodyweight exercises like push-ups, squats, and lunges can be highly effective in improving muscular strength.
12. How long does it take to see improvements in body composition?
The time it takes to see improvements in body composition varies from person to person and depends on factors such as diet, exercise routine, and genetics.
13. Is it possible to improve all components of physical fitness simultaneously?
Yes, it is possible to improve all components of physical fitness simultaneously following a well-rounded exercise program that includes cardiovascular exercises, strength training, flexibility exercises, and a balanced diet.
14. Can physical fitness be maintained without going to a gym?
Yes, physical fitness can be maintained without going to a gym. There are numerous activities that can be done at home or outdoors, such as walking, jogging, bodyweight exercises, and yoga.
